Output e8e5003dc69becc4209586f61bad8aa26f95ced337072486de1e5177ba1a14bc: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b655c61bfa5bc6d50331ef2833832acf718b16 OP_EQUAL
address
3AgxaCqCBYaXecLyP9Y6SF5iAEqmseNAwQ
transaction
e8e5003dc69becc4209586f61bad8aa26f95ced337072486de1e5177ba1a14bc
confirmations
467897
spent
true